Jersey Dairy ice cream helps launch film festival

01/09/2009

Branchage Jersey International Film Festival launched its 2009 Programme last week to 300 press and industry representatives at London’s trendy Idea Generation Gallery. Guests were treated to complimentary Jersey Dairy Ice Cream and a specially created Branchage Cocktail, a tasty Mojito-style drink mixed with the exciting newly imported spirit Hierbas. DJs opened the night, before announcements from Festival representatives and patrons and a live music set from the up-and-coming band Plaster of Paris. There was also a work-inprogress display of 3D time-lapse films shot aroundJersey by artists Brian McClave, Gavin Peacock and Darren Umney.

 

Festival Founder and Director Xanthe Hamilton welcomed the guests and thanked sponsors Jersey Trust Company and Spearpoint who are supporting the festival for a second year. She also thanked Barclays Wealth who recently joined the festival’s supporters to present the Barclay’s Wealth Speigeltent, a beautiful 600-capacity tent which will add some real magic to St Helier. The tent will host opulent parties by night and free film training sessions, part of the Shooting People Filmmakers Campus, by day. James Mullighan, Creative Director of independent filmmakers network Shooting People said in his speech “Shooting People is a proud partner of Branchage - the hottest new film festival around. In seemingly no time, Xanthe Hamilton and her team have put Jersey on the International Film Festival map. As well as an intriguing programme of films, there’s a film market swiftly establishing itself on the island. It’s not one for sales agents and distributors - it’s a market of filmmakers.”

 

Festival Patron Simon Chinn, producer of the Oscar and BAFTA-winning film Man on Wire which opened the 2008 Festival spoke to the crowd about the fantastic time he had had at the festival last year, and encouraged other filmmakers to make the trip to Jerseyfor a unique and rewarding festival experience. He said “Run by a dynamic young team of film lovers and film makers, Branchage - now in just its second year - has the kind of youthful verve and imagination that many of the more established festivals can now only dream of. It’s a festival I’m proud to be associated with.” Festival Programmer Philip Ilson spoke about the extraordinary selection of films and venues used in this year’s festival, from Jersey Opera House to a Drive-In Cinema at People’s Park, and from Jersey War Tunnels to The Magistrates Court. Branchage Jersey International Film Festival will take place at an array of atmospheric and inspirational venues across the island from 1st – 4th October 2009.
